In a Child in Need of Care case, the court decides if and how the state will become involved to protect a child. Under the Revised Kansas Code for the Care of Children, a child is a Child in Need of Care if one or more of the legal grounds is proved. Your Rights and Responsibilities: 1. How to fill out the KS Information for Interested Parties online

Filling out the KS Information for Interested Parties form is a crucial step for those looking to participate in a Child in Need of Care case. This guide will provide you with clear, step-by-step instructions on how to properly complete each section of the form online.

Follow the steps to successfully complete your form online.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in your preferred browser.
  2. Begin with the personal information section. Fill in your full name, address, and contact information accurately to ensure the court can reach you regarding important updates.
  3. Proceed to the relationship section. Here, describe your relationship to the child involved in the case. It’s important to indicate if you have lived with the child for a significant period within six months prior to the case.
  4. Next, fill out the section regarding your rights as an interested party. Make sure to acknowledge your understanding of the rights and responsibilities outlined in the form.
  5. Review the notice of proceedings section to confirm you understand that you will receive notifications related to hearings and decisions affecting the child.
  6. Lastly, conclude by reviewing all provided information for accuracy. After confirming everything is correct, you can save the changes, download the completed form, print it, or share it as required.

In legal terms, an interested party is a person or entity that has something to gain or lose from the outcome of a case. This could involve anyone whose rights or interests may be affected by the court's decision. Recognizing the significance of interested parties is essential in legal proceedings to uphold justice.
